At takeoff a commercial jet has a 55.0 m/s speed. Its tires have a diameter of 0.550 m.

(a) At how many rpm are the tires rotating? rpm

(b) What is the centripetal acceleration at the edge of the tire? m/s2

(c) With what force must a determined 10-15 kg bacterium cling to the rim? N

(d) Take the ratio of this force to the bacterium's weight. (force from part (c) / bacterium's weight)
